One of the standout purposes of AI in CNC milling is predictive routine maintenance. By analyzing large amounts of operational data, AI algorithms can forecast each time a machine element may are unsuccessful or have to have servicing. This proactive technique lessens downtime and extends the machine’s lifespan.
